| Pin | Function | Notes | |------|-------------------------------|-----------------------------------| | 1 | Injector cylinder #1 | Ground-switched by ECU | | 2 | Injector cylinder #2 | | | 3 | Injector cylinder #3 | | | 4 | Injector cylinder #4 | | | 5 | Injector cylinder #5 | (6-cyl engines use pins 5 & 16) | | 6 | Injector cylinder #6 | | | 7 | Main relay control | ECU grounds to activate | | 8 | Fuel pump relay control | | | 9 | Idle control valve (ICV) | Duty cycle signal | | 10 | Speed output (to cluster) | Sometimes TTL signal | | 11 | Diagnostic request (pin 15 of DLC) | | | 12 | Check engine light | Ground to illuminate | | 13 | Power ground | To engine block | | 14 | Signal ground | For sensors | | 15 | +12V battery constant (pin 30) | Keep-alive for adaptation | | 16 | +12V ignition switched (pin 15) | Main ECU power | | 17 | Crankshaft position sensor (signal) | VR sensor (AC voltage) | | 18 | Crankshaft sensor (shield/ground) | | | 19 | Crankshaft sensor (negative) | | | 24 | Throttle position sensor (wiper) | 0.5V – 4.5V | | 25 | TPS reference voltage (5V) | | | 26 | TPS ground | | | 27 | Coolant temp sensor | Voltage divider output | | 28 | Intake air temp sensor | | | 44 | Oxygen sensor signal | 0.1V – 0.9V | | 52 | Ignition output #1 | To ignition coil/transistor |
